とはハイパフォーマンス ストレージ?
ハイパフォーマンス ストレージとは、大量のデータを卓越した速度、効率性、信頼性で処理するために設計された特殊なストレージソリューションを指します。高速なデータアクセス、低遅延、高スループットが求められる環境に最適化されており、膨大なデータセットを迅速に処理する必要のあるアプリケーションにとって不可欠な資産となります。ハイパフォーマンス ストレージソリューションは、ソリッドステートドライブ(SSD)、 NVMe (不揮発性メモリ)などの高度なテクノロジーを活用しています。メモリー Express)、場合によってはRAMベースのストレージを組み合わせることで、従来のストレージシステムに比べて高速なデータアクセス速度を実現します。
ハイパフォーマンス ストレージソリューションでは、データの読み書きを並列で行うことができ、速度と効率がさらに向上します。複数のデータ操作を同時に実行することで、これらのシステムは、特に負荷の高い環境で、レイテンシを最小限に抑え、スループットを最大化します。SSDなどのテクノロジーとNVMe 並列データ処理に特に適しています。複数のデータブロックに同時にアクセスできるため、従来のストレージに見られる逐次的な読み書き処理の制約を回避できます。この並列化は、継続的かつ高速なデータアクセスを必要とするアプリケーションにとって不可欠です。
これらのソリューションは、 HPC科学研究、人工知能(AI)、メディア制作、金融サービスなど、データ集約型の分野で広く採用されています。レイテンシを最小限に抑え、データ転送速度を向上させることで、ハイパフォーマンスストレージは、負荷の高いワークロード下でも、システムが高い生産性と応答性を維持できるようにします。
ハイパフォーマンス ストレージ:開発タイムライン
開発ハイパフォーマンス ストレージは、企業や研究機関のデータニーズの増加とともに進化してきました。以下は、主要なイノベーションを示す簡略化されたタイムラインです。ハイパフォーマンス ストレージ:
- 1960年代~1970年代:初期のディスクドライブとRAID技術
- IBMは1960年代にハードディスクドライブ(HDD)を開発し、磁気ディスクへのデータ保存と検索を可能にした。容量には限りがあったものの、これらのドライブは将来のストレージソリューションの基礎を築いた。
- 1970年代には、RAID(Redundant Array of Independent Disks)技術が登場し、データを複数のドライブに分散させることでストレージのパフォーマンスと信頼性を向上させました。RAIDは耐障害性を高め、データ取得速度を向上させ、ストレージの未来への重要な一歩となりました。ハイパフォーマンス ストレージシステム。
- 1980年代~1990年代:SCSI、NAS、SAN技術
- 小型コンピュータシステムの開発インタフェース SCSI(システムケーブル挿入インターフェース)とNAS(ネットワーク接続ストレージ)は、データアクセス速度とネットワークベースのストレージ機能の進歩をもたらしました。SCSIはより高速なデータ転送速度を実現し、NASは企業向け専用ファイルストレージソリューションを導入することで、ネットワークベースのデータストレージを変革しました。
- この時期には、ファイバーチャネル(FC)技術とストレージエリアネットワーク(SAN)も導入されました。これらの技術革新により、企業は高速性、信頼性、冗長性を向上させた状態で大容量データを管理・アクセスできるようになり、これはエンタープライズレベルのアプリケーションにとって不可欠な要素となりました。
- 2000年代~2010年代:SSDの台頭、 NVMe 、 そしてクラウド ストレージ
- 2000年代には、ソリッドステートドライブ(SSD)がよりコスト効率の良いものとなり、従来のHDDよりもはるかに高速で、レイテンシが低く、IOPS(1秒あたりの入出力操作数)も高くなった。メモリー これらのSSDを有効にすることで、高速なデータアクセスが求められる環境において不可欠なものとなった。
- 2010年代には、非揮発性メモリー 急行 ( NVMe従来の限界を克服して登場したSATA インターフェース。 NVMe 利用するPCIe バスは、遅延を低減してより高速なデータ転送を促進する。同時に、クラウド ストレージは、拡張性とアクセス性を提供し、注目を集めている。ハイパフォーマンス 多様なワークロードに対応するストレージソリューション。
- 2020年代:AIを活用した最適化と計算ストレージ
- 人工知能(AI)と機械学習の統合により、インテリジェントなストレージ最適化が可能になり、リアルタイムの使用パターンに基づいてデータアクセスと配置が改善されました。さらに、処理能力とストレージユニットを組み合わせたコンピュテーショナルストレージは、データ処理のための革新的なソリューションになりつつあります。ハイパフォーマンス ワークロード、特にデータ量の多い環境において。
関連製品およびソリューション
利点ハイパフォーマンス ストレージ
ハイパフォーマンス ストレージは、膨大なデータセットを扱う業界や、高速なデータ処理を必要とする業界において、大きな利点を提供します。低遅延と高スループットを提供することで、ハイパフォーマンス ストレージシステムにより、企業はデータへのアクセスと取得を高速化でき、より迅速な意思決定と生産性の向上につながります。これらのソリューションは、金融サービス、ヘルスケア、メディア制作など、1ミリ秒が重要な分野で不可欠です。たとえば、金融取引では、ハイパフォーマンス ストレージはリアルタイムのデータアクセスを保証し、より迅速なトランザクションと正確な分析を可能にします。
科学研究、人工知能、機械学習において、ハイパフォーマンス ストレージを利用することで、組織は膨大な量のデータをかつてないスピードで処理・分析できるようになる。ハイパフォーマンス ストレージソリューションは、大規模で複雑なデータセットを処理し、ボトルネックなしで高負荷のワークロードをサポートします。この容量により、AI向けのデータ処理がよりスムーズになります。トレーニング モデル、ゲノム研究、リアルタイムシミュレーション。信頼性と耐久性が向上し、ハイパフォーマンス ストレージはダウンタイムを削減し、ミッションクリティカルな環境における継続的な運用を保証します。
課題と考慮事項ハイパフォーマンス ストレージ
実装ハイパフォーマンス ストレージソリューションには、主に複雑さとインフラストラクチャとの互換性に関する特有の課題と考慮事項が伴います。ハイパフォーマンス ストレージ技術、例えばNVMe SSDや高度なコンピューティングストレージソリューションは、従来のストレージシステムよりも高価になる傾向があります。予算が限られている組織にとって、これらの高度なストレージソリューションの購入、導入、および維持にかかるコストは障壁となる可能性があります。さらに、統合ハイパフォーマンス 既存のインフラストラクチャにストレージを組み込むには、専門的な知識が必要となる場合があり、また、データスループットの向上とレイテンシの最小化をサポートするためのアップグレードが必要になる可能性もあります。
拡張性とデータ管理も、採用する際の重要な考慮事項です。ハイパフォーマンス ストレージ。データ需要が増加するにつれて、組織はパフォーマンスの低下なしに増加するワークロードに適応できるスケーラブルなソリューションを必要とします。ストレージシステムが現在および将来のデータ要件の両方に適切に設計されていることを確認することが重要です。さらに、データの整合性とセキュリティの管理は、ハイパフォーマンス データは頻繁にアクセスされ、高速で転送されるため、ストレージは重要です。これらの課題に対処するために、組織は、データの保護とコンプライアンスを確保するために、堅牢なデータ管理プロトコルとサイバーセキュリティ対策を必要とします。ハイパフォーマンス 環境。
よくある質問
- ストレージシステムのパフォーマンスを測定する4つの指標とは何ですか?
ストレージシステムの主要なパフォーマンス指標は、レイテンシ、IOPS(1秒あたりの入出力操作数)、スループット、および容量の4つです。レイテンシとは、データ要求から応答までの時間遅延を指し、高速なデータアクセスを必要とするアプリケーションにとって不可欠です。IOPSは、ストレージシステムが1秒あたりに実行できる読み取りおよび書き込み操作の数を測定し、システムの応答性を示します。スループットは、一定時間内に転送されるデータ量を定量化したもので、通常はMB/秒またはGB/秒で測定され、大容量ファイルの転送において重要です。容量は、ストレージシステムが保持できるデータの総量であり、長期的なデータニーズに対応するストレージソリューションを評価する上で不可欠です。 - ストレージのIOPSはどのように計算するのですか?
IOPSを計算するには、操作あたりの平均応答時間(ミリ秒)と実行されたI/O操作の数を測定します。計算式は次のとおりです。IOPS = 1秒(1000ミリ秒)/操作あたりの平均応答時間(ミリ秒)。たとえば、ストレージシステムの平均応答時間が5ミリ秒の場合、IOPSは200(1000ミリ秒/5ミリ秒)と計算されます。この計算結果は、読み書きパターンやブロックサイズなどの要因によって若干異なる場合があります。 - コンピューティング ストレージはハイパフォーマンスストレージをどのように強化しますか?
コンピュテーショナルストレージは、処理機能をストレージデバイスに直接統合することで、データをCPUに転送することなくローカルで処理することを可能にします。この革新的な技術により、データ転送時間が短縮され、CPU負荷が最小限に抑えられるため、AI、機械学習、リアルタイム分析といったデータ集約型アプリケーションのパフォーマンスが向上します。コンピュテーショナルストレージは、高速なデータ処理が不可欠であり、従来のCPUベースの処理がボトルネックとなる環境で特に有効です。